Gambling has been around since ancient times and has been a popular pastime for centuries. From playing dice in the Roman Empire to modern casinos, gambling is a phenomenon that continues to evolve and captivate people around the world. In this article, we will take a look at the history of gambling and explore how it has changed over time.
In its earliest form, gambling was simply a way of passing time and entertainment for the masses. Ancient civilizations such as Egypt, Greece, and Rome used games like dice and knucklebones for entertainment purposes. These primitive forms of gambling were viewed as harmless fun by the public and helped bring people together to enjoy each other’s company in an informal setting.
As time passed by, gambling began to take on more organized forms with large-scale tournaments taking place throughout Europe during the Middle Ages. These games were often used as fundraisers or as a way to settle disputes between nobility. Gambling also began to spread into other cultures during this period with Japan introducing their own version of shogi (Japanese chess) in 1603.
The introduction of the printing press in 1450 made it easier for books about gaming to be printed and distributed throughout Europe which further popularized gambling among Europeans. By 1700s, most major European cities had some sort of casino where people could gamble freely on card games such as poker or baccarat. The casinos soon became places where wealthy people could congregate socially as well as gamble their money away on high stakes games of chance.
At this time, many countries started making laws restricting or banning certain types of gambling while others attempted to regulate it heavily by taxing winnings or imposing limits on bets. This led to a rise in underground gambling dens where people could still partake in illegal activities without fear of punishment from authorities.
The 20th century saw great advancements in technology which revolutionized how gambling was played and enjoyed by people around the world. The first slot machines were introduced during this era along with video poker machines which allowed players to play multiple hands at once at different denominations simultaneously. Lotteries also became widely available with many states opting to legalize them as a way of raising revenue quickly without having to raise taxes on citizens directly.
